DISCUSSION
City Council approval is requested to amend contract No. 34895 with LAZ Parking California, LLC (LAZ), to continue providing citywide parking operations and management services.

On November 7, 2017, the City Council adopted RFP No. PW17-033 and concurrently awarded a contract to LAZ to provide citywide parking operations and management services.

On June 19, 2018, the City Council approved an amendment to Contract No. 34895 with LAZ to increase the contract authority and expand its scope of services to provide operations and management services at three new parking assets upon the expiration of the City’s 15-year agreement with DDR Management, LLC (DDR,) on May 31, 2018, who previously managed operations and maintenance at these three parking assets.

On January 7, 2020, the City Council approved an amendment to increase the contract authority to support several citywide parking projects. LAZ’s parking operations expertise and support assisted Public Works in delivering various citywide parking improvements and initiatives, including: new parking and revenue control systems at Civic Center and City Place C structures, upgraded camera surveillance system at Aquarium structure, COVID-19 Parking Permit Relief Program management, LED lighting upgrades at Civic Center structure, and tenant improvements to the City’s parking office.
